OWL Genomics Technology - Metabolomics applications

Pharmaceutical applications

Matabolomics can play a key role in drug development and discovery, from the identification of biomarkers for safety or toxicity, through to drug efficacy and action mechanism studies.

  • Drug Toxicity / Efficacy

    In-vivo endogenous metabolic profiles are compared before and after drug administration, revealing markers of drug toxicity / efficacy. Xenobiotic drug metabolites can also be investigated in the same experiment.
     
  • Reactive Metabolite Screening

    Reactive metabolite formation is an important factor in the understanding of drug toxicity. Analytical methods have been validated in our laboratory for the assessment of reactive metabolite formation from toxic drugs in human hepatocytes.

 

Clinical applications

Metabolomics delivers new tools for disease diagnosis and treatment assessment / prediction of response to treatment. Two different approaches to this problem are commonly employed at OWL Genomics:

  • Targeted metabolic profiling experiments

    , when an array of metabolites known to be involved in a given biochemical pathway are analysed. This procedure is optimised by performing recovery experiments on representative quantities of each metabolite throughout the analysis procedure. Specialised procedures for the determination of methionine cycle metabolites involved in liver related pathologies have been validated in our laboratory for serum and tissues samples.
  • Metabolic fingerprinting

    , where all detected components are included in the analysis, provides more holistic approach to exploring the multiple factors governing a biological organism.
